Subtract 30/20 from 12/50
1st number: 12/50, 2nd number: 1 10/20
12/50 - 30/20 is -63/50.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 50 and 20 is 100
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 100 - For the 1st fraction, since 50 × 2 = 100,
12/50 = 12 × 2/50 × 2 = 24/100 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 5 = 100,
30/20 = 30 × 5/20 × 5 = 150/100 - Subtract the two like fractions:
24/100 - 150/100 = 24 - 150/100 = -126/100 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-63/50
